Raipur. If it comes to Chhattisgarh, then the name of Bastar definitely comes. Bastar is identified with its rich folk art, culture and traditions. This folk culture gives Chhattisgarh a distinct identity in the country and abroad. The important part of this tradition is Bastaria dance, which is a traditional and lively dance form associated with the soil of Bastar.
Tradition of generations of tribal community
Ranjita Kumari Gavadi, a resident of village Kadme near Koylibeda in Bastar, says that the matter of Bastaria dance is unique. This dance has been performed by generations by the tribal community of Bastar. Especially on occasions like tribal day, big events are held in Bastar, where a large number of people gather and participate in this dance.
Special costumes increase dance
Ranjita says that the special thing about Bastaria dance is that both men and women dance together. Women wear traditional costumes during the dance, which include Rupee Mala, Paurychi, Suta, Sari, Kardhan and Morpankh in the head. These dresses increase the beauty of dance more.
Men also take part in sharing
Bhishma Kumar, a resident of Bastar, says that men also enjoy this dance as much. They play drums at the time of dancing, wear suta and garland and tie a traditional turban on the head. Bhishma says that he has been watching and doing this dance since childhood. Bastaria dance has become a part of his life.
